Supply Chain Issues in the Army Industry

The armed forces's unique operational requirements present significant challenges to its logistics network. Maintaining a constant flow of vital equipment and resources across diverse, often austere, environments demands an exceptionally robust and adaptable system. Recent events have highlighted vulnerabilities in this linkage, including dependency on overseas vendors for key components, unpredictable transportation delays due to geopolitical instability or natural disasters, and the complexities of managing a vast inventory dispersed across global locations. Further complicating matters is the need for strict adherence to stringent quality standards and the imperative to rapidly adapt to evolving threat landscapes requiring new technologies and quickly sourced capabilities.

Understanding Demand in the Modern Army Market

The shifting military landscape necessitates a thorough understanding of demand within the modern Army market. Historically, procurement selections were often driven by conventional needs, click here but today’s dynamic environment—characterized by rapid technological advancements and emerging geopolitical challenges—presents a far more intricate picture. Demand is no longer simply about acquiring standard equipment ; it encompasses a broad spectrum of requirements including advanced communication systems, cybersecurity solutions, robotic platforms, and specialized training programs. This rising demand isn't solely dictated by threat assessment; factors such as force modernization plans, budgetary constraints, operational tempo, and the need for agile response capabilities significantly influence procurement priorities. Furthermore, the Army’s focus on multi-domain operations necessitates a shift from siloed acquisitions toward integrated solutions – driving demand for interoperable systems capable of seamlessly functioning across land, air, sea, cyber, and space domains. Understanding these intricate drivers is crucial for suppliers seeking to effectively engage with the U.S. Army and provide valuable support.
